Gyeongnam and Ulsan meet at Changwon Football Center, in a match for the 20th round of the K League. Ulsan won at home by (2-0) the last time they met in this edition of the league, on 28-04 -2019. The record of direct confrontations in this stadium is favorable to the visiting team, which in the last 4 matches won 2 and tied 2. but the last time these two teams met in this stadium was on 08-15-2018, for the Liga K, which ended in a draw by (3-3). Choi Young-Jun (81 ') and Marcão (90' e 90 ') scored the goals of the match, for Gyeongnam, and Junior Negao (24' e 69 ') and Kim Seung-Jun (33'), for Ulsan . In the last round of the South Korean championship, the formation led by Kim Jong-Boo failed again, however, with a point won in the move to Daegu, with a tie to a ball. A result that, nevertheless, turned out to be positive, since it was the Daegu who scored first, at 48 ', with Gyeongnam showing resistance and restoring the tie at 69', by Choi Jae-Soo. The moment of form, however, is far from being the best: it was the eighth consecutive game of the Changwon team without winning.

The Ulsan Hyundai will have the opportunity to reach, even temporarily, the leadership of the championship if it manages to win, since the Ulsan has one less game compared to the Jeonbuk, which would be great news for the fans of the team. On the last day, Kim Do-Hoon's team suffered, but managed to win 1-0 against Incheon United. It was the return to victories, after two consecutive games without a win, including elimination in the Asian Champions League at the hands of Urawa Reds. The Brazilian Junior Negão was the hero of the match, scoring the winning goal in the 86th minute, when the tie was expected at Ulsan Munsu Football Stadium.
